Patsy was born October 29, 1933 in Holstein, Iowa the daughter of Earl and Mabel Ellerbusch. She attended Holstein High School where she graduated in1951. She married Dale Huenecke of Holstein on August 24, 1952 and they spent the next 57 years together before Dale lost his battle to cancer in 2009. Following their wedding, Patsy worked the books at her father’s hatchery while Dale served time in the army. When Dale returned, Patsy and Dale took over the Huenecke family farm and raised 5 children there: Joni, Jeri, Marty, Tammy and Tom. They instilled in their children a strong work ethic and the importance of family love and loyalty.
Patsy enjoyed cooking and baking, hosting family and friends, playing bridge and cribbage, investing in the stock market, and working on the farm. She loved to entertain and was always known in the family to be the pie maker for holidays and special events.
In 1989 Patsy and Dale bought a 2nd home in Okoboji. They were blessed to gain an expanded network of friends who would often gather on their deck to enjoy the beautiful lake view……and perhaps a couple of cocktails. Patsy always took time to visit with anyone who stopped by. And she loved swimming in the lake and going for long walks. She will be remembered by all who knew her as a caring and intelligent woman. Though dementia won out in the end, she never lost her ability to laugh and love.
Patsy leaves behind her loving partner, Ed Hendrickson. Patsy and Ed shared a love of Okoboji lake life, travel, and frequent visits to family and friends.
